Mysql provides standardsbased drivers for jdbc, odbc, and. Ant script to create mysql table this example illustrates how to create table through the build. Sqlexception no suitable driver download people who like this. Our main application works fine with the mariadb client, but when using ant and jdbc to execute database preparation operations, such as. The mysql driver for also called connector is a native mysql driver for. Liquibase can be controlled via a maven plugin which can be obtained from the central maven. If the command line interface does not fit your needs, liquibase can be run on maven or ant. Issue the following command to compile the driver and create a. They are the class to import, the driver name to register in. Operation hangs when using ant and mariadb jdbc driver. This creates a build directory in the current directory. Use mysql as drivername and a valid dsn as datasourcename. Because the original lib is not maintained anymore, we use it in ob1k, and would like to remove.
Hi, i am trying to execute sql file using sqlexec class in ant api, but throwing the following exception. Mysql connectors mysql provides standardsbased drivers for jdbc, odbc, and. Passing additional properties using a database url. Using jdbc with mysql tutorial and example code for java. With mysql connectorj, the name of this class is com. Source file or fileset, transactions or sql statement must be set. The basic mysql jdbc driver and java mysql url information you need is shown here. The goal is to support the three most recent versions mysql drivers, and efforts with authors from the open source community to constantly improve the functionality and usability of mysql drivers continue. I have a table called build where i store version numbers of the software. Am trying to build database using sql script with ant sql task java. Connect to a mysql data source sql server import and. With this method, you could use an external configuration file to supply the driver class name and driver parameters to use when connecting to a database. This project is a port of mauriciopostgresqlasync to kotlin.
Alternatively, you can set the values of those properties through the ant d options. In order to connect to mysql database, you need jdbc driver for mysql. Jdbcodbc adds an extra level of indirection to the connection and is generally speaking more difficult to install but. A list of drivers that have been tested and found to be compatible with azure database for mysql 5. As a 100% pure java jdbc driver, the mysql driver integrates seamlessly with popular ides like eclipse, intellij and netbeans, as well as any javaj2ee application. Some jdbc drivers including the oracle thin driver, use the jvms proxy settings to route their jdbc operations to the database. I want to get the latest build number through sql and assign it into a variable in ant. Go mysql driver is a mysql driver for gos golang databasesql package.
Code issues 46 pull requests 12 actions projects 0 wiki security insights. If you look at the database, youll see the following structure. This example illustrates how to create table through the build. Net driver for mysql connectornet odbc driver for mysql connectorodbc. The mysql odbc driver is a powerful tool that allows you to connect with live mysql data, directly from any applications that support odbc connectivity. Well see these reasons in more detail in this article. Mysql data type to java data type conversion table. If you have difficulties in creating the tables using ant, you can also execute the sql script generated in. Here are the specifics necessary in order to use the mysql jdbc driver. Your property mysqldriver should point to a jar file.
Download the binary distribution of torqueanttasks. I want to run a select statement and assign the value to the variable. Content reproduced on this site is the property of the respective holders. We already did that by adding the mysql driver jar to the libant directory of your project. We use mysql as database, and ant and jdbc to prepare test databases. Can you share a javamysql jdbc driver and url example, i. Every vendor is responsible to implement this class for their databases.
Databasedriversmysql nativeoverview apache openoffice. If the program executes successfully, then the following output will be displayed. Getting started the java tutorials jdbctm database. Heres a quick post to help anyone that needs a quick mysql jdbc driver and url reference. Mysql stored procedure create problem using ant builder. We recently switched over from commercial mysql driver, to the mariadb client. To run it with java command, we need to load the mysql jdbc driver manually. Till now i showed you how to use command line commands with and without the perties file. In addition, a native c library allows developers to embed mysql directly into their applications. Java db comes with two type 4 drivers, an embedded driver and a network client driver. Before the development of the conenctor, has used jdbcodbc to connect to the mysql server.
I am using the following ant sql task and its throwing no. To user i am new to mysql and i am attempting to port an application from postgresql. Net framework data provider for odbc as the data source on the choose a data source or choose a destination page. Getting started the java tutorials jdbctm database access. Odbc drivers arent listed in the dropdown list of data sources. Try to run the application and i get the same results. To connect with an odbc driver, start by selecting the. Sql92 queries are seamlessly translated to mysql syntax. Verified in the jboss as management console that the human task service is running. The bundled ant build file contains targets like test and testmultijvm, which can facilitate the process of running the connectorj tests.
Ensure the db\driver has the right driver in the directory. This provider acts as a wrapper around the odbc driver. One of the things i do in the development stage is create the databases for the application in an ant script so its easy to create them and they are always the same. Go mysql driver is an implementation of gos databasesqldriver interface. The earfile argument is an expanded directory or java archive file with a.
The following connects to the database given in url as the sa user using the org. Ant properties in the nested text will not be expanded. Download mysql jdbc driver from here mysql jdbc driver download here. Installing a jdbc driver generally consists of copying the driver to your computer, then adding the location of it to your class path. A number of ant properties for building connectorj from source have been renamed. A git client, if you want to check out the sources from our github repository available from. Driver error while connecting to mysql database from java program. Connectorodbc is a standardized database driver for windows, linux, mac os x, and unix platforms. These drivers are developed and maintained by the mysql community. Specify to the drivermanager which jdbc drivers to try to make connections with. You may be running your java application directly from command prompt, shell script, ant or eclipse.
1233 1132 521 1173 588 45 482 704 1153 7 1377 1545 698 169 1511 14 213 136 1392 1200 598 1150 823 1353 1229 1115 1044 195 316 689